Emission Savings Tracker

The Emission Savings Tracker is Jupital Pro’s sustainability monitoring tool designed to help riders and organizations measure their positive environmental impact. By tracking the reduction in carbon emissions achieved through the use of Jupital Pro electric vehicles, users can visualize their contribution to cleaner cities and a healthier planet.

3. How It Works
The Emission Savings Tracker uses data from:

  • Distance traveled (km or miles) via Jupital Pro vehicles.
  • Average CO₂ emissions from equivalent petrol vehicles.
  • Electric energy consumption during charging (for accurate net savings).

The system then calculates: CO₂ Saved=(Distance Traveled×Average Fuel Vehicle Emission Rate)−(Energy Used×Electric Grid Emission Rate)\text{CO₂ Saved} = (\text{Distance Traveled} × \text{Average Fuel Vehicle Emission Rate}) – (\text{Energy Used} × \text{Electric Grid Emission Rate})CO₂ Saved=(Distance Traveled×Average Fuel Vehicle Emission Rate)−(Energy Used×Electric Grid Emission Rate)

Example:

  • 1 km on a petrol scooter = 72 g of CO₂ emitted
  • 1 km on Jupital Pro electric scooter = 10 g CO₂ (grid electricity)
  • Emission saving per km: 62 g CO₂

So, for 1,000 km of riding:
62 kg of CO₂ saved

4. Key Metrics Displayed

  • Total Distance Traveled (km)
  • CO₂ Emissions Avoided (kg or tons)
  • Equivalent Trees Planted (based on 21 kg CO₂ absorbed per tree/year)
  • Fuel Saved (liters of petrol not used)
  • Energy Used (kWh consumed for charging)
  • Total Cost Savings (based on average fuel prices vs electricity rates)
